This E ring is a small metal retaining clip that secures shafts, pulleys, and other rotating parts to prevent axial movement. It restores correct part positioning so assemblies run smoothly and stay aligned. What it does:
- Acts as a snap/retaining ring to hold components on a shaft or in a groove
- Prevents pulleys, bearings, or spacers from sliding out of place
- Common symptom: loose or shifting pulley, increased wobble, noise, or component disengagement
- Small, inexpensive part whose failure can allow adjacent parts to migrate and cause additional damage
What's included: One E ring Install notes:
- Disconnect power to the appliance before beginning any repair
- Use snap-ring pliers or needle-nose pliers and wear eye protection when installing or removing
- Ensure clip seats fully in the shaft groove and that mating surfaces are clean and undamaged
- Replace any damaged mating hardware rather than reusing a deformed clip

The Switch Mounting Screw is an OEM part compatible with Whirlpool washing machines. This screw securely mounts the cycle selector switch within the control console assembly. Proper fastening ensures dependable operation of control functions.
Causes of a bad mounting screw can stem from stress cracks developing over multiple years of operation. Vibrations accumulate, slowly loosening connections housed in a wet environment.
Symptoms of a bad mounting screw include:
- Loose or rattling switch within the console face
- Difficulty selecting cycles as buttons wobble out of place
- Water intrusion hastening corrosion of electrical terminals
- Potential shock hazards if live connections are exposed

This agitate gear washer is a small flat washer used with the washer's agitate gear to ensure proper spacing and smooth engagement. It helps maintain correct gear alignment so the agitator can move laundry effectively. What it does:
- Provides a stable spacer between the agitate gear and mating components to prevent excess play
- Helps maintain correct gear alignment for consistent agitator movement
- Reduces metal-on-metal contact that can cause noise or premature wear
- Commonly replaced when the agitator feels loose, makes grinding noise, or causes uneven agitation
What's included: One agitate gear flat washer. Install notes:
- High-level replacement: remove agitator/gear per service manual to access washer; reinstall in original orientation
- Use manufacturer torque/settings for reassembly; do not overtighten
- Inspect adjacent gear and splines for wear; replace any damaged components
- Disconnect power and follow safety procedures before servicing the washer

This is an outer tub for washing machines. The outer tub and holds the inner tub and makes sure water doesn't leak into the rest of the appliance. A damaged outer tub will often make loud noises and could cause leaks.When replacing the outer tub, make sure the washing machine is unplugged and the water supply is turned off. Remove the control panel before disassembling the washing machine to get access to the outer tub. Tap the drive block and disconnect the outer tub before pulling the hose free and removing the suspension springs. The new part can be installed in the new place before turning the power and water back on.
